Adam West, best known for his role in the 1960s Television series 'Batman,' has succumbed to Leukemia.

He was 88 years old at the time of his passing. According to Variety, West passed away on Friday evening with his loved ones by his side. He leaves behind a wife, their six wonderful children, and several grandchildren and great-grandchildren.

'Batman' aired on the ABC network in 1966 and became a hit -- albeit, it was an unexpected hit. Following 'Batman,' West had several roles in other TV series and movies. You may also know of West as the voice of a character on 'Family Guy' -- the one and only Mayor Adam West.

Upon news of his passing, fans and stars alike took to social media to express their sorrow over West's death.
